Hosted by Joose Toiviainen from Daze, this event will be a blend of learning and fun. Taking place at the Antler office in Punavuori, we'll kick things off at 5:00 PM with engaging guests who are ready to share their experiences in the world of e-com.

4:30 PM - Doors open
5:15 PM - The role of Design in e-commerce with Jani Reijonen from Adventure Club
5:45 PM - Fireside chat with Antti Moilanen from eBrands
6:15 PM - Drinks & snacks

Speakers:

Jani Reijonen - Design Lead @ Adventure Club
Visual storyteller with 12+ years of experience in designing both Digital and Brand experiences. Has crafted meaningful experiences across diverse industries, from emerging technologies to heavy industries both locally and internationally. Lately the focus has been on helping e-commerce in Finland.

Antti Moilanen - Head of Partnerships @ eBrands
Nearly 20 years of experience in global e-commerce, marketing, digitalisation & commercial strategy with consumer brands and B2B. Previously held leadership roles in consulting and agency businesses. Antti is leading the eBrands Partner Platform business.
